I have a brand new iMac, shipped Sept 12, 2007 with the latest version of OS/X. I also have a G4 AGP PowerMac using the latest version of OS/X.
When I power up the iMac it always initially have an internet connection. I can reach a web site within the first 30 sec or so. But after getting into the web site connection is lost. NOTE: This is at startup regardless of "waking" from sleep or powering up fresh. It happens EVERY time.
The G4, running at the same time, has none of these problems. It wakes or cold starts and achieves internet connection and retains that connection right along while the iMac loses it.
Since both have the same version of OS I have to blame the hardware.

No resolution as yet. I was on and off my machine frequently over the weekend, putting it to sleep and waking it, etc. Not a scientific study but enough to determine that I am not figuring it out.
I have noticed that when I delay accessing the internet there is more of a chance of getting a connection first time. When I do some work in desktop program such as Photoshop for a few minutes then attempt connection I get in almost every time. I have also noticed that web sites that do not push a lot of content seem to connect more often first time as well. One fairly consistent thing: if I don't get a connection then wait for a while without going through the troubleshooting dialogs I often suddenly have a connection. Bizarre.
There seems to be more chance of getting connection the first time when I am on Ethernet v. wireless connection.
All that being said, without a discernable pattern I am no closer to figuring this thing out than before. The observations I have from a weekend of use don't give me a clear direction for troubleshooting this.
I can't blame the router; my wife's PC uses an Ethernet connection and has no connection problems at all. My G4 Power Mac connects no problem. It's just the iMac.
